Job Description:
Are you passionate about shaping the future of entertainment
through the power of voice, and AI? Prime Video is reimagining how
customers discover, engage with, and talk about their favorite
shows, movies, and live sports — and conversation design is at the
heart of that transformation. The Prime Video UX team is seeking a
customer-obsessed Principal Conversation System Designer to join
our team and define the future of AI-powered conversational
experiences across Prime Video's global platform. This role will be
responsible for crafting the voice, tone, language framework and
interaction design behind how customers engage with Prime Video
through natural language — whether through voice interfaces, AI
assistants, or chat-based discovery features. The right candidate
leads with clarity and empathy, inspires others, and has a passion
for solving problems at massive scale. To thrive in this role, you
must be a pioneer with an inventor's spirit and a deep
understanding of language — both inputs and outputs — who is
passionate about technology and innovation. You know how to work
fast, manage multiple projects, and understand how to embed your
thinking to train and tune scaled LLM output . You must be
comfortable working with product briefs, managing stakeholder
inputs, functional requirements, and timelines. You have a solid
understanding of conversation design fundamentals combined with a
deep understanding of how to collaborate with UX designers,
researchers, product management, engineering, data science, and
operational teams as you go from early-stage product concepts to
launches of new features and experiences. Key job responsibilities
* Define the overall conversation design vision for AI-powered
discovery, recommendation, and engagement experiences across Prime
Video's global platform. * Create world-class, user-centered
conversational experiences through consideration of UX research,
market research, business requirements, customer feedback, and
usability study findings. * Work with Science and Editorial teams
to help train and refine LLMs to generate content that matches the
intention of the designs and the Prime Video brand voice. *
Demonstrate leadership in driving conversation design processes and
standards into the organization that help refine strategy and
elevate quality. * Translate business requirements into use cases
and high-level customer experience requirements for conversational
interfaces. * Design the interaction flow, dialogue logic, and
response frameworks for new AI-powered features. * Develop and
maintain detailed conversation design specifications, including
sample dialogues, error handling flows, and edge case
documentation. * Present design work to the UX team, product team,
engineering team, Amazon leadership, and external partners for
review and feedback. * Mentor other conversation and UX designers
and be a bar-raiser for quality of work. * Work across design
verticals to standardize and educate others on conversation design
systems and voice/tone guidelines. * Collaborate with other design
team members on experiences, frameworks, process, and best
practices. * 10 years of design experience, with a significant
focus on conversation design, voice UX, or AI/LLM-powered
experiences * Have an available online portfolio demonstrating
conversation design work * Experience with best practices for
Conversation Design, Interaction Design, and Information
Architecture * Experience in lifecycle design projects from design
strategy through execution * Deep understanding of natural language
processing (NLP) concepts and how they inform design decisions *
Experience designing for voice assistants, chatbots, or AI-powered
interfaces * Experience working with LLM-based products and prompt
design or content strategy for generative AI * Familiarity with
design tools such as Figma, Voiceflow, or equivalent conversation
design tools * Experience in the entertainment, media, or streaming
industry * Demonstrated ability to mentor and develop other
designers * Strong written communication and storytelling skills
